Ultrasonic response anisotropic electrostatic spinning patch and preparation method thereof

The invention discloses an anisotropic electrostatic spinning patch with ultrasonic response and a preparation method thereof, a fiber membrane with a controllable anisotropic structure is constructed by a biodegradable polymer, antibacterial nanoparticles and a photoinitiator system through a step-by-step directional electrostatic spinning process, so that the mechanical matching property of the fiber membrane is improved; cell growth can be directionally guided and tissue regeneration can be accelerated by combining the piezoelectric material characteristics of the introduced biodegradable polymer with piezoelectric characteristics and electric field stimulation induced by the fiber topological structure; meanwhile, a zwitterionic coating is generated on the surface of the fiber membrane in situ by utilizing a single-sided photocuring technology, and an anti-adhesion function is realized on the single side of the fiber membrane. Furthermore, the soft tissue repair patch which has multiple functions of adjustable mechanical property, infection resistance, adhesion resistance and the like and has better structural mechanical suitability, function integration and tissue regeneration guiding capability is prepared by adopting the anisotropic electrostatic spinning patch with ultrasonic response.

Soft tissue repair patch and method of making same

The application belongs to the technical field of medical materials, and discloses a soft tissue repair patch and a preparation method thereof, which comprises the following steps: S1, treating and cleaning animal soft tissue to obtain a first intermediate product; S2, adding the first intermediate product into a reagent to perform freeze-thaw circulation to obtain a second intermediate product; S3, soaking and treating the second intermediate product with an organic solvent and cleaning to obtain a third intermediate product; S4, soaking and treating the third intermediate product with an alkali solution and cleaning to obtain a fourth intermediate product; and S5, soaking and treating the fourth intermediate product with an acid solution, cleaning, drying and sterilizing to obtain the soft tissue repair patch. The application provides a more gentle and friendly decellularization scheme, and the decellularized matrix prepared by using the scheme is more completely decellularized, has no chemical residue, and maintains the natural scaffold structure of collagen.

Preparation method and application of organic-inorganic composite hydrogel with high mechanical adaptability and wet adhesion stability

The invention discloses a preparation method and application of organic-inorganic composite hydrogel with high mechanical adaptability and wet adhesion stability, and belongs to the technical field of biomedical tissue engineering. The hydrogel is prepared from the following components in percentage by mass: 8.125 percent to 65 percent of calcium phosphate and 35 percent to 91.875 percent of lipoic acid. The bionic wound dressing is beneficial to proliferation and migration of fibroblasts, and more ideal soft tissue regeneration is realized. Experimental results prove that the suture has good cytocompatibility, can quickly promote rat skin defect repair (20 + / -1mm limit skin injury repair time is shortened to 2 weeks), and has a more remarkable healing effect compared with a contrast traditional suture and gauze with an optimal clinical repair effect. The organic-inorganic composite hydrogel with high mechanical adaptability and wet adhesion stability prepared by the invention shows good mechanical properties, also has excellent adhesion, and is beneficial to soft tissue repair.

Double-layer GBR membrane for promoting soft and hard tissue repair as well as preparation method and application of double-layer GBR membrane

PendingCN121265877ASurgeryOsteocyteHard tissue
The invention discloses a double-layer GBR membrane for promoting soft and hard tissue repair and a preparation method and application thereof, and is applied to the field of medical materials. The double-layer GBR membrane mainly comprises an acellular dermal matrix obtained by decellularizing fetal calfskin and a piezoelectric layer prepared by electrostatic spinning of poly-L-lactic acid and chitosan, and the acellular dermal matrix and the piezoelectric layer are further combined through a polydopamine coating prepared on the surface of the piezoelectric layer. During application, the acellular dermal matrix side faces the soft tissue side, and the piezoelectric layer faces the bone tissue side, so that the acellular dermal matrix skin side which is compact in structure is in contact with the soft tissue to play a barrier role, and the relatively loose piezoelectric layer is in contact with bone defects to play a role in guiding osteoblasts to adhere; functionally, soft tissue repair is promoted through the angiogenesis promoting effect of the acellular dermal matrix and the similarity of the tissue of the acellular dermal matrix, and bone regeneration of a bone defect area is promoted through the piezoelectric osteogenesis and angiogenesis effects of the piezoelectric layer.

Repair film and preparation method thereof

The invention discloses a repair membrane and a preparation method thereof, and relates to the technical field of biological materials, the preparation method comprises the following steps: S1, preparing a polymer membrane; s2, mixing the polymer membrane with a natural polymer material solution, and performing one-way freezing to prepare a through hole structure; and S3, crosslinking the composite membrane of the polymer and the natural polymer material to obtain the repair membrane. According to the repair membrane and the preparation method thereof, the prepared repair membrane takes a high polymer material as a support and a slow degradation inner layer, and takes a cross-linked natural high polymer material with a one-way channel as a guide outer layer. When the composite material is applied to soft tissue repair, such as smooth muscles, blood vessels and tendons, the gelatin one-way channel can guide cells to directionally migrate, adhere, proliferate and arrange, and macromolecules on the inner layer can ensure the matching between the degradation rate of the material and tissue growth, so that the composite material can achieve a better tissue repair effect.

Bone plating sytem

The invention provides an integrated orthopedic fixation system that enhances precision, reproducibility, and biomechanical stability in bone and soft-tissue repair. In one aspect, a loop suture includes one or more integrally formed loops spaced along its length, each functioning as a selectable tensioning point that enables a surgeon to incrementally "dial in" soft-tissue tension without manual knot-tying. In another aspect, a bone plate with a slip-knot pathway incorporates strategically oriented holes, tunnels, and slots configured to guide a suture in a unidirectional, self-locking manner, forming a stable, knotless construct. In a further aspect, a lateral ulna plate is anatomically contoured for placement on the lateral surface of the proximal ulna and integrates the slip-knot suture pathway to provide rigid fracture fixation while minimizing hardware prominence and optimizing triceps-tendon tension control. The combined system allows precise, repeatable, and adjustable fixation of bone and soft tissue using a single low-profile implant platform.

Porous polycaprolactone microsphere for tissue filling and preparation method thereof

PendingCN122005925Agood monodispersityavoid resistanceProsthesisTissue repairOil emulsion
The invention discloses porous polycaprolactone microspheres for tissue filling and a preparation method of the porous polycaprolactone microspheres, and relates to the field of biomedical materials. The microsphere is composed of polycaprolactone, the diameter of the microsphere is 40-70 [mu] m, the dispersion coefficient of the microsphere is less than 5%, the porosity of the microsphere is 55-85%, and the surface of the microsphere is provided with a uniform open pore structure formed by tridecane. According to the preparation method, a microfluidic technology is adopted, a tridecane-containing polycaprolactone dichloromethane solution is taken as a dispersion phase, a polyvinyl alcohol aqueous solution is taken as a continuous phase, an oil-in-water emulsion is formed through microchannel shearing, and curing, washing and freeze-drying are performed to obtain the tridecane-containing polycaprolactone / polyvinyl alcohol composite material. The microspheres disclosed by the invention have excellent monodispersity and a porous structure, and can remarkably promote fibroblast proliferation and collagen secretion and induce moderate inflammatory response to activate tissue regeneration. The process is simple and controllable, and the obtained microspheres have injectability and a tissue repair promoting function and have application prospects in the field of soft tissue repair.

Soft tissue repair material as well as preparation method and application thereof

PendingCN121779680ATissue regenerationProsthesisPolyesterLysine diisocyanate
The invention relates to the technical field of soft tissue repair materials, in particular to a soft tissue repair material and a preparation method and application thereof. The invention relates to a polyurethane elastomer, which is prepared from an alternating block copolymer, the alternating block copolymer is obtained by reaction of polyester polyol, polyether polyol and diisocyanate, the use amount of diisocyanate accounts for 4-12% of the total mass of polyether polyol, polyester polyol and diisocyanate, and the use amount of polyurethane accounts for 1-5% of the total mass of polyether polyol, polyester polyol and diisocyanate. The diisocyanate is at least one or a combination of lysine diisocyanate and 1, 4-butane diisocyanate. The soft tissue repair material has an excellent repair effect and can be completely biodegraded, a degradation product cannot cause adverse reaction in vivo, and the soft tissue repair material is free of immunogenicity, has good biocompatibility and mechanical performance and can meet the core requirement of the soft tissue repair material.
